Great results for young Cantabrians at the Anchor AIMS GAMES

Last week, some of our juniors took part in the Anchor AIMS GAMES in Tauranga. The games are an Intermediate/Middle School Championship, with over 10,000 competitors in 21 sports.

Well done to Tom Marshall, Ryan Ko, Charlie Prince, Chris Hebberd, who all finished in the top 10 of the boy’s competition. Tom Marshall and Chris Hebberd representing Bohally Intermediate finished 4nd & 10th, Ryan Ko representing Heaton Intermediate finished 5th and Charlie Prince representing Kaikoura High School finished 7th. Tom and Chris also won Silver for Bohally Intermediate in the team’s event.  Tom is off to C Grade Nationals next week with two other of Marlborough Squash Rackets juniors - Henry and Paul Moran.

In the girl’s competition, Petra Curd-McCullough & Caitlin Millard representing Heaton Intermediate won the school teams cup and gold medal each in the team’s event along with Petra winning a bronze medal & Caitlin finishing 4th in the individual event.
